Situation of refugees in the Middle East

Recommendation 566 (1969)

Assembly debate on 30 September 1969 (10th Sitting) (see Doc. 2634, report of the Committee on Population and Refugees). Text adopted by the Assembly on 30 September 1969 (10th Sitting).
Thesaurus

The Assembly,

1. Recalling its Recommendation 520 of 2 February 1968 and considering that the lot of the refugees in the Middle East has not improved but has appreciably deteriorated;
2. Considering that an intensified effort on the part of the international community is indispensable to prevent the great majority of these refugees from having to rely for many more years on international charity;
3. Believing that one of the best ways of improving the lot of refugees is to provide them with vocational training for the employment already available or to be created in the host countries or elsewhere in the near future;
4. Considering that the Council of Europe, the depository of the moral and humanitarian values of European civilisation, is in duty bound to continue to contribute towards a solution of this problem,
5. Recommends that the Committee of Ministers invite member governments to increase further and to continue their regular and special financial contributions to the United Nations Relief and Works Agency for Palestine Refugees (UNRWA) and to give their political and moral support to that organisation's work and to the work of other United Nations specialised agencies and non-governmental organisations such as the League of Red Cross Societies so as to enable refugees in the Middle East to revert to a normal life.
